Example marketing and sales coordinator requirements on a job description

Marketing and sales coordinator requirements can be divided into technical requirements and required soft skills. The lists below show the most common requirements included in marketing and sales coordinator job postings.
Sample marketing and sales coordinator requirements
  • Bachelor’s degree in marketing or related field
  • 2+ years of marketing and sales experience
  • Proficient in MS Office applications
  • Knowledge of graphic design software
  • Familiarity with analytics software
Sample required marketing and sales coordinator soft skills
  • Excellent communication and interpersonal skills
  • Strong organizational and problem-solving skills
  • Creative and analytical thinking
  • Ability to work independently and in a team
  • Flexible and responsive to changing priorities

Marketing and sales coordinator job description example 3

SmithBucklin marketing and sales coordinator job description

Smithbucklin, a 100 percent employee-owned association management company, is looking for a Creative Sales Marketing Coordinator to join our Sales Services team in Washington D.C.. Our team of professionals manage every facet and detail of the sales process to drive growth for our client organizations through the marketing and selling of their print and digital ad properties, exhibit space and sponsorship assets. This is an exciting and challenging position for a high-energy, detail-oriented individual with a keen interest in digital media, print media and in-person events. When you join our team, you'll be part of a group of media professionals who use imagination, solid experience, a winning attitude and a competitive spirit to exceed client expectations.

The Creative Sales Marketing Coordinator is responsible for designing, writing and deploying compelling email promotions, media kits, prospectuses and other marketing materials with a focus on B2B Sales. This role requires the ability to work collaboratively and effectively across multiple projects. They will also be responsible for client relations and other account management duties for several key association clients.
What You Will Do

+ Work in a multi-client, advertising agency-like atmosphere

+ Design media kits and promotional sales pieces for association clients

+ Compose and design promotional e-marketing messages to support sales efforts

+ Execute preflight processes and maintain detailed production reports

+ Manage new and existing client databases and contracts

+ Maintain regular communication with advertisers regarding upcoming deadlines and ad material collection

+ Participate in client meetings and attend conferences and tradeshows on an as-needed basis

+ Prospect new advertisers and/or clients

+ Monitor general site statistics for clients' websites and digital products (e.g., eNewsletters, eblasts and webinars) using Google Analytics or similar software

+ Partner with the sales team, association and production teams to improve campaign performance based on client goal

+ Maintain and submit various client reports

This Role Might Be for You If...

+ You are a problem solver with a high degree of energy

+ You have a demonstrated willingness to take on new and challenging projects

+ You thrive in a dynamic, fast-paced, deadline-driven environment

+ You possess an intense attention to detail and accuracy

+ You exhibit the ability to work autonomously and manage own projects

+ You have the ability to communicate ideas effectively

+ You have the ability to travel up to 5%

Basic Qualifications

+ Bachelor's degree from an accredited four-year college or university

+ 1-3 years of relevant professional experience

+ Experience with the design and creation of copy and graphics for a variety of marketing materials with a focus on B2B sales

+ Proven skills in Adobe Photoshop, Illustrator and InDesign

Preferred Qualifications

+ Experience in publishing, advertising or similar industries

+ Experience with CRM systems, Salesforce a plus

+ Experience with HTML, CSS and JavaScript

+ Experience with Dreamweaver

+ Skill and experience using Microsoft Excel and other programs within the Microsoft Office Suite

+ Ad trafficking experience with a major commercial ad serving platform, such as DART for Publishers, Atlas, SmartAdServer

+ Familiarity with Interactive Advertising Bureau (IAB) standards and best practices is a plus
